Updated: PlayStation Stars Campaign Guide For November 2022; Bonus Reward for Returnal Players and PlayStation Eye Owners

Now that Oct. is behind us, PlayStation Stars has updated revealing a number of new campaigns. This month is very different from last month, suggesting we will see more variety than a set rotation.

For collectibles, there is an arcade machine for playing Guilty Gear Strive, Dragonball Fighter Z, Street Fighter V, Ultimate Marvel vs. Capcom 3, Mortal Kombat 11 or Tekken 7. We can also confirm loading any of these games will immediately unlock the reward.

Anyone looking for bonus points have two missions they can complete. The first gives an additional points for purchasing Call of Duty: Modern Warfare II – Cross-Gen Bundle, New Tales from the Borderlands, Brewmaster – Beer Brewing Simulator, Gotham Knights, PGA 2K23 Cross-Gen Edition or the PlayStation 5 version of NHL 23. In addition to that, Nov. is the first month to award points without spending money. Players earn 75 points by using Remote Play for 20 minutes.

Finally, Returnal players can earn an additional reward for killing the first boss, Phrike. This should instantly unlock for anyone who previously completed the task, and while reports have not confirmed it, appear following Phrike’s defeat for newcomers. After unlocking, playing any game will instantly unlock the figure.

For those on the fence, this is a pretty doable task. The first boss can be defeated in roughly 30 minutes, it just depends on how skilled and lucky you are. Given all the quality of life changes, there really isn’t a better time to give it a try.

While this covers all currently known challenges, make sure to check back to see if any limited time or other conditional tasks are discovered.

Update: Earlier today Sony added two additional campaigns for this month.

Similar to last month, there is a Nov. check-in quest. This is completed by playing any game and gives another Tyrannosaurus Rex collectible. In addition to that, select players were given a special PlayStation Eye campaign.

Based off the description this is a bonus for PlayStation Eye owners. The exact conditions to unlock are unclear, some have reported they owned one and played games with it and still don’t have it, but we can personally confirm getting the collectible. Like other optional campaigns, this unlocks after booting any PlayStation 4 or 5 game.
